The Sinai Peninsula and Christian Egypt. St Catherine’s Monastery
Theodora Videscu St Catherine’s Monastery on the Sinai Peninsula, one of the oldest Orthodox monastic settlements in the world, is presented in the context of its biblical history, the role of Empress Helena and Emperor Justinian in its foundation, as well as its links with Romanian rulers such as Constantin Brâncoveanu and Metropolitan Antim Ivireanul, who was exiled to Sinai.
